Last official estimated population of Morris city (Stevens County**, Minnesota state) was 5,357 (year 2014)[1]. This was 0.002% of total US population and 0.1% of total Minnesota state population. Area of Morris city is 5.0 mi² (=13 km²)[6], in this year population density was 1,068.20 p/mi². If population growth rate would be same as in period 2010-2014 (+0.33%/yr), Morris city population in 2026 would be 5,576*.
